Got a question: I am 72 years old, 5'6", have a motorcycle license but almost no practice - have always enjoyed bicycles. My wife and I have a summer place, in/near the country of your (and my late parents') origin. We want to buy a Vespa 125cc or 300cc to ride together around town and especially over a hill to run errands. I like the idea of the 300cc for carrying two riders, but wonder about handling the heavier of the two scooters. Any comments? Mnogo hvala!
@nemanjatosovic
@nemanjatosovic 10 ай бұрын
Scooters are generally very easy to ride. Of course, the heavier and larger they are the more intimidating they’ll be especially to new riders. A 125cc Vespa is around 70-80 pounds lighter compared to a 300 so it’ll feel nimbler and lighter between your legs. It’s also smaller in size so it won’t feel intimidating. 125cc is enough for in city use, I ride my 125 Yamaha Zuma and it’s plenty powerful and quick enough, it can also maintain its speed on steepish hills. Vespa also offers a 150cc version of their primavera and sprint models, it’s probably worth it upgrading to it if you’re not a fan of the bulkier 300. Although the 125/150cc are nimbler, the 300’s increase in power more than makes up for it. The GTS 300 is a very capable machine and it’s a pretty much do it all scooter however if you never plan on getting outside of the town, it’s probably an overkill. To simply answer your question, if you don’t plan on taking longer trips, (50 miles or more) and just need something small, nimble, easy to ride, but can still do the speed limit, can carry two, go with the 125 or better yet a 150. If you think you may find yourself exploring the country, riding town to town, taking longer trips, the 300 is probably a better choice as it’ll be a lot more comfortable and you never feel like you’re lacking power.
